What Is
Scoliosis?
Scoliosis is a condition that causes an abnormal sideways curve in the spine, often resembling an “S” or “C” shape. While the spine naturally has curves, scoliosis involves a deviation that can affect posture, balance, and overall comfort. This condition typically starts during rapid growth periods before puberty but can also be present or undetected in adulthood, sometimes only revealed through an X-ray or physical exam years later.
In most cases, scoliosis is mild and doesn’t present obvious symptoms. However, as the curvature worsens, it can lead to pain, muscle imbalances, or posture changes that impact daily life. Many individuals may not notice their scoliosis until it is diagnosed through an X-ray or physical examination, highlighting the importance of early detection to prevent potential complications.
Key facts about scoliosis:
- It is a sideways curvature of the spine, not just poor posture.
- It typically begins in children or teens during growth spurts.
- It can go undiagnosed into adulthood, sometimes only discovered when back pain or posture issues arise.
Common signs of scoliosis include:
- Uneven or unlevel shoulders
- Tilted or raised hips
- A ribcage that appears more prominent on one side
- A visible shift in the waist or trunk to one side
If you or a loved one observe any warning signs, particularly during the adolescent growth phase or following a period of significant growth, it is essential to seek a professional evaluation. The earlier scoliosis is detected, the more effective and non-invasive treatment options become, leading to better long-term health and well-being.

Is Scoliosis Curable?
Scoliosis is not typically considered “curable” in the conventional sense, but that doesn’t mean there’s no hope for patients. It results in a structural change to the spine that usually cannot be fully reversed. However, scoliosis is highly treatable and manageable, especially when diagnosed early and treated with ongoing care.

How do I know if I have scoliosis?
Scoliosis can be difficult to notice in its early stages, as symptoms may not be immediately apparent. Some common signs to look for include uneven shoulders, a tilted waist, or one side of the ribcage appearing more prominent than the other. However, the only accurate way to diagnose scoliosis is through a professional spinal evaluation, usually involving an X-ray. If you notice any changes in your posture or have been advised that your posture could improve, it’s worth scheduling an assessment.
Is scoliosis painful?
Scoliosis does not always lead to pain, especially in younger individuals, but it can cause discomfort as the condition worsens or if left untreated. For adults, scoliosis may lead to muscle tightness, fatigue, and chronic pain in the back or neck. The degree of pain typically depends on the severity of the curvature and its impact on the surrounding muscles and joints.

Can scoliosis get worse over time?
Yes, scoliosis can worsen, particularly during the rapid growth phases of adolescence or due to degenerative changes in adulthood. Curves greater than 25 degrees are more likely to progress if not properly managed. Early diagnosis and proactive treatment are key to controlling the condition and preventing future complications.

Do you use any special equipment in scoliosis care?
Yes, we utilize various specialized therapies and tools to support spinal correction and balance muscle function:
- Electric Muscle Stimulation (EMS): This therapy uses electrical impulses to relax muscle spasms and re-educate weak muscles.
- VibraCussor: A handheld device that creates vibration waves, helping to loosen fascia, improve circulation, and relieve muscle tension.
- Ultrasound Therapy: Applies deep heat to soft tissue to reduce inflammation, improve blood flow, and alleviate pain, typically used before spinal adjustments.
- Spinal Traction Rolls: These are used to gently stretch the spine, increase flexibility, and reduce disc pressure.
